Utah Postgame Notes
at Arizona
Nov. 14, 2015
Utah falls to 8-2, 5-2 in the Pac-12 South. The Utes fall to 20-19-2 all-time against Arizona. The Utes are 19-24 in league games as a member of the Pac-12 Conference.
The Utes are 9-8 all-time in overtime games. Utah has played at least one overtime game each of the past seven seasons. The Utes played three overtime games last year, including two in double overtime (Oregon State and Stanford).
The Utes surpassed 400 total yards for the third time this season (442 yards).
Travis Wilson had his 16th career 200-yard passing game (20-for-31 for 219 yards, one INT) and his fifth this year. He threw for two touchdowns (2 and 59 yards) to bring his season total to 12 and his career total to 53. Wilson broke the school career record for total touchdowns with 73 (53 passing, 20 rushing), breaking the record of 72 set by Scott Mitchell (1987-89).
Devontae Booker had 145 yards rushing on 34 carries. He scored on a 1-yard touchdown run in the first quarter for his 11th TD of the season (tied for fifth-most all-time) and his 21 career rushing touchdowns puts him solely into fifth place all-time at Utah. It was Booker's 14th career 100-yard rushing game, tying the school record set by John White. He tied his season-high 34 carries for the third time this season. He also moved into fourth place in career carries at Utah (560, passing John White) and third place in career yards (2,773, passing Chris Fuamatu-Ma'afala). Booker also had 15 yards receiving (three catches) for 160 all-purpose yards.
Kenneth Scott caught a two-yard touchdown in the second quarter, his third touchdown reception of the season. He drew two pass interference penalties on the drive, bringing his season total to nine. He had three catches for 18 yards.
Joe Williams saw his most action at running back this season and had a career-high 37 yards on seven carries. He also caught three passes for 13 yards.
Harrison Handley caught a 59-yard touchdown reception on Utah's first drive of the second half. It was a career-long reception and his fourth touchdown of the year. He led Utah with 69 yards on two catches.
Britain Covey had 112 all-purpose yards, which included 10 rushing yards (one carry), 68 receiving yards (four catches) and 36 yards on kick returns (one return).
Andy Phillips made field goals of 34, 38 and 40 yards (3-for-3) and broke the Utah school record for career field goals made with 58. The previous record of 57 was set by Louie Sakoda (2005-08).
Brian Allen made his first career start at right corner. He made his first career interception in the third quarter.
Justin Thomas made his third interception of the season (also his career total) in the fourth quarter.
Marcus Williams led Utah with eight tackles (one TFL, one pass breakup).
